Using Policy and Law to Help Reduce Endometriosis Diagnostic Delay
Annika J Penzer1, Scott J Schweikart2
1Fourth-year undergraduate student at Stanford University in Stanford, California.
Abstract:
Despite high incidence of endometriosis internationally and domestically, many patients wait a decade after symptom onset for an accurate diagnosis. This article suggests why diagnostic criteria should be clarified and why endometriosis screening should be incentivized among members of the public, clinicians, and health care organizations.
